在日常工作中,我们经常需要对Excel表格中的数据进行计算和处理。其中,涉及减法运算的情况并不少见。尤其是在需要从一个较大的数值中扣除多个较小数值时,手动逐个输入公式显然效率低下。因此,掌握如何快速实现多个单元格求减数的方法显得尤为重要。
方法一:使用减法公式
最基础也是最常用的方式是利用Excel内置的减法功能。假设A列存放被减数,B列存放减数,C列为结果列。那么可以在C2单元格输入以下公式:
```
=A2-SUM(B2:Bn)
```
这里的`B2:Bn`表示你希望参与相减的所有减数所在的区域范围。通过这种方式,可以一次性完成多个减数的累加,并从对应的被减数中扣除总和。
方法二:利用数组公式(适用于Excel 365或更高版本)
如果你使用的是支持动态数组功能的Excel版本,则可以采用更简洁的方式来处理这一问题。例如,在C2单元格输入如下公式:
```
=A2-SUM(B2:Bn)
```
按下Enter键后,Excel会自动将结果扩展到与之对应的一系列行中,无需手动填充每个单元格。
方法三:创建自定义函数
对于频繁使用的复杂操作,创建一个自定义函数可能会更加高效。以下是VBA代码示例,用于创建名为“MultiSubtract”的函数:
```vba
Function MultiSubtract(Base As Double, ParamArray Subtractors() As Variant) As Double
Dim i As Integer
MultiSubtract = Base
For i = LBound(Subtractors) To UBound(Subtractors)
MultiSubtract = MultiSubtract - Subtractors(i)
Next i
End Function
```
之后,只需在工作表中调用此函数即可,比如:
```
=MultiSubtract(A2,B2:Bn)
```
这种方法不仅简化了操作流程,还增强了灵活性。
注意事项
- 在使用上述任何一种方法之前,请确保所有相关数据已经正确输入。
- 如果存在非数值型数据,请先检查并清理这些异常值。
- 根据实际需求调整公式中的参数范围,避免因误操作而导致错误结果。
通过以上几种方式,您可以轻松地在Excel中实现多个单元格求减数的操作。选择最适合自己的方法,不仅可以提高工作效率,还能减少出错几率。希望本文提供的技巧能帮助您更好地应对日常工作中的各种挑战!